Inspection Process
- Aircraft should park in the “red box” directly in front of the CBP GAF.
- The aircraft control tower can direct you in if needed.
- A CBP Officer will meet the aircraft on the ramp to begin the inspection.
- All crew and passengers will be processed inside the CBP GAF.
- Be prepared to present passports, visas, pilot’s license, medical certificate, aircraft registration, and user fee decal (if appropriate).
- Regulated waste/garbage will be collected by CBP.
Procedures
Permission to Land
Commercial aircraft operators departing the U.S. must obtain an outbound clearance by contacting CBP directly. Pilots must secure permission to land by contacting CBP directly, during regular office hours, prior to departure from the foreign port or place and at least two hours in advance of the anticipated arrival time at Toledo Express Airport. Permission to land is granted with a tolerance of (+/-) 30 minutes. If your ETA deviates outside these parameters, previously granted permission(s) are invalid and you must contact CBP to re-secure permission to land.

Unknown- (419) 656-7106 CBP Toledo/Sandusky Duty Phone is monitored 0800-2200 daily.
- TSB2@cbp.dhs.gov is not monitored after hours.
- Pilots should be aware that landing rights can be denied if inspection service cannot be provided.
- After hours service is available on a case-by case basis subject to approval by the Port Director; requests must be made during regular office hours except in an emergency.
- Weekend and holiday landing rights requests must be made prior to Friday at 1600 hours (ET).
- Advise CBP if transporting commercial imports, weapons, or live animals.
